No New Rule 8.4(h) For Tennessee
The Tennessee Supreme Court has entered an order denying the petition of its Board of Professional Responsibility to amend its Rule 8.4 to add a subsectuon (h) prohibiting engaging “in a professional capacity, in certain discriminatory conduct.”
The court concluded that the rule and comment to subsection (d)(conduct prejudicial to the administation of justice), which tracks the ABA Model Rules, sufficiently deals with the issue. (Mike Frisch)
